magenxcommerce/module-page-builder

页面构建模块

安装: 0

依赖: 2

建议者: 2

安全: 0

星标: 0

关注者: 1

分支: 0

开放问题: 0

语言:JavaScript

类型:magento2-module

2.2.1-p1 2021-10-21 22:05 UTC

This package is auto-updated.

Last update: 2024-09-22 05:08:01 UTC


README

The Magento_PageBuilder module provides an enhancement for the default Magento WYSIWYG editor. It installs an alternative editor in the Admin area for building content.

PageBuilder编辑器可以在以下内容页面上使用

  • 分类页面
  • CMS页面
  • CMS块
  • 动态块

启用模块

PageBuilder模块和编辑器在安装后默认启用。

编辑器本身在管理员区域的商店 > 配置 > 内容管理 > 高级内容工具 > 启用页面构建器下全局启用。此设置确定is_pagebuilder_enabled配置值。

禁用模块

您可以通过在XML配置文件中的字段配置中添加以下条目来禁用特定字段的PageBuilder模块

<item name="wysiwygConfigData" xsi:type="array">
    <item name="is_pagebuilder_enabled" xsi:type="boolean">false</item>
</item>

示例

以下示例禁用了内容字段的PageBuilder编辑器。

<form x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:module:Magento_Ui:etc/ui_configuration.xsd">
    <fieldset name="content" sortOrder="10">
        <field name="content" formElement="wysiwyg">
            <argument name="data" xsi:type="array">
                <item name="config" xsi:type="array">
                    <item name="source" xsi:type="string">page</item>
                    <item name="wysiwygConfigData" xsi:type="array">
                        <item name="is_pagebuilder_enabled" xsi:type="boolean">false</item>
                    </item>
                </item>
            </argument>
        </field>
    </fieldset>
</form>

注意: 以这种方式禁用编辑器会覆盖指定字段的is_pagebuilder_enabled值。